Job Description

Join USAA as an Injury Examiner, where you will adjust complex bodily injury claims and ensure compliance with state laws while delivering exceptional member service. This full-time hybrid role offers a fulfilling career path in a supportive environment dedicated to the military community.

Key Responsibilities

  • Adjust complex auto bodily injury claims and UM/UIM claims
  • Investigate loss details and determine legal liability
  • Evaluate, negotiate, and adjudicate claims
  • Manage assigned claims workload and keep parties informed
  • Collaborate with team members and direct vendors for claims resolution
  • Deliver best-in-class member service
  • Support workload surges and catastrophe response operations
  • Work various types of claims, including higher complexity claims
  • Ensure compliance with risk and compliance policies

Required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or General Equivalency Diploma
  • 4 years auto claims and injury adjusting experience
  • Advanced knowledge of auto claims contracts, investigation, evaluation, negotiation, and adjudication
  • Advanced negotiation, investigation, communication, and conflict resolution skills
  • Strong time-management and decision-making skills
  • Investigatory, prioritizing, multi-tasking, and problem-solving skills
  • Advanced knowledge of human anatomy and medical terminology
  • Ability to exercise sound financial judgment
  • Advanced knowledge of coverage evaluation and loss reserving
  • Acquisition and maintenance of insurance adjuster license within 90 days and 3 attempts

Preferred Qualifications

  • 2 or more years of catastrophic injury experience
  • Experience handling UM/UIM injury claims
  • College Degree (Bachelor’s or higher)
  • Insurance Designation
